Position Summary
ABCD & Company is seeking a highly organized, detail-oriented Creative Services Coordinator to support the operations and strategic growth of the Creative Department. The role bridges creative execution with departmental oversight, ensuring seamless project coordination, accurate reporting, and improved organizational efficiency. The ideal candidate thrives in a dynamic environment, has a strong grasp of project management, and is eager to contribute to a creative team that supports client delivery, internal marketing, and business development. There is opportunity for growth into a more senior operations or project management role over time.
Key Responsibilities
- Project Management & Workflow Coordination: Coordinate and track creative project timelines, resource allocation, and team assignments using tools such as Asana, Trello, or Monday.com.
- Facilitate clear communication between the Creative Department and cross-functional teams to maintain project momentum.
- Act as a liaison between the Creative Department and other teams to ensure output is strategically aligned, brand-consistent, and timely.
- Anticipate roadblocks, identify solutions, and escalate issues to reduce bottlenecks and missed deadlines.
- Administrative & Resource Management: Collect and organize creative briefs and project inputs from internal and external stakeholders. Ensure designers and the multimedia team receive accurate, timely information. Maintain a structured archive of brand assets, templates, and final deliverables.
- Client & Business Development Support: Assist in developing sales materials and client-facing presentations. Organize and archive case studies and assets for business development and marketing use. Coordinate revisions, feedback loops, and delivery of creative assets with clients and internal stakeholders.
- Creative Department Oversight & Strategic Support: Oversee strategic initiatives, key performance objectives, and departmental activities. Support execution of assignments related to strategic initiatives under guidance of the Chief Creative Officer. Collect and analyze departmental performance data; prepare reports. Assist in managing the Creative Department’s annual budget. Maintain records of activities, financials, and travel receipts; support data organization for budgets. Support resource planning and allocation; monitor progress against department goals and recommend improvements.
- Cross-Departmental & Internal Planning: Participate in internal planning meetings; distribute agendas, take minutes, and share follow-up recaps. Support logistics for Creative and iLab events in line with agency strategies.

Required Qualifications
- 2-3 years of experience in project coordination, creative services, marketing, or administrative support (agency or creative environment strongly preferred).
- Familiarity with creative workflows and tools (Adobe Creative Suite, Canva, Figma; video production a plus).
- Proficiency in project management tools such as Asana, Trello, Wrike, or Monday.com.
- Strong ability to collect, analyze, and present data to inform decisions and track performance.
- Demonstrated 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ously with strong attention to detail.
- Moderate skills in presentation design (PowerPoint, Google Slides, or Keynote) preferred.
